    FIGURE G in A Revision Of The New World Moth Genus Hübner (Lepidoptera: Erebidae)

    No full text
    FIGURE G (terminology for bursa copulatrix, A. ciboney exemplar): 1) Socket (receptacle for male clasper) 2) ostium bursae 3) ductus bursae 4) strap-like sclerotized area (a signum condition) 5) corpora bursae 6) seventh sternite (subgenital plate) 7) ductus seminalis 8) appendix bursae.Published as part of Adams, Morton S. & Mccabe, Timothy L., 2022, A Revision Of The New World Moth Genus Hübner (Lepidoptera: Erebidae), pp. 1-47 in Zootaxa 5105 (1) on page 9, DOI: 10.11646/zootaxa.5105.1.1, http://zenodo.org/record/633225
